Why ceremonial grade matters here

When you're brewing matcha through a pod system, the quality of the powder is everything. Culinary-grade matcha is designed for baking — it's more bitter, less refined, and the flavour profile doesn't hold up when you're drinking it straight.

Ceremonial grade matcha is stone-ground from the youngest tea leaves, shaded before harvest to maximise chlorophyll and L-theanine content. It's what traditional Japanese tea ceremony uses. And it's what PODHAUS puts in every pod.

The result is a cup that's smooth rather than sharp, grounding rather than jittery — closer to how matcha is supposed to taste.

The difference between a good cup and a great one

Temperature and ratio matter even with pods. If your machine runs hotter than usual, let it do a brief rinse cycle before brewing your matcha — starting with clean, properly tempered water makes a noticeable difference in the final taste.
